Hash in Binance refers to a function that converts an input of any length into a fixed-size output, typically used for data integrity, security, and encryption in cryptocurrency transactions. Binance, as a cryptocurrency exchange, utilizes hash functions like SHA256 to secure transactions and ensure data authenticity. What is hash in Binance?
